Output 595faa72a6efee99b1efc0459a89cfde315def08fe2518f28b5fd6bf2a449f03:1

value
173268304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643211908e89e90beaf4df127994f60304a77500 OP_EQUAL
address
MH2wnSZ4HiQt9wBXo23ZoY2jDqPFc2yh6y
transaction
595faa72a6efee99b1efc0459a89cfde315def08fe2518f28b5fd6bf2a449f03
spent
true